Open-source has changed the manner in which software is written and distributed. More. Besides, they efficiently function offline and can be uploaded to the app stores like the native ones. For more information about managing packages and plugins, refer to Using Packages. We need offline copy of the flutter documentation: Zablon Dawit: 11/11/18 5:03 AM: enough said. Why use the SQFlite plugin? It provides support for both iOS and Android platforms (offcourse). Flutter being a cross-platform development tool enables you to create performance-oriented applications in no time. Flutter takes this to a whole new level by allowing us to effectively ignore the entire platform. If you added Analytics, run your app to send verification to Firebase that you've successfully integrated Firebase. There is an --offline flag that you can pass to flutter create: –[no-]offline When “flutter packages get” is run by the create command, this indicates whether to run it in offline mode or not. It is quite easy to customize as per your need for News publishing requirement. To facilitate the process of creating a new Flutter project, you will use the Flutter CLI tool. To do this, open your terminal and navigate to your projects directory to run the following command: flutter create --org com.auth0 flutterdemo. flutter_offline package; documentation; flutter_offline package. Service. If you simply type release you should be able to find the Flutter Run main.dart in Release Mode command. Network-Only: In rare cases when you don’t want to keep the cache of data, then you can use the Network Only mode of the Flutter GraphQL library. flutter_offline API docs, for the Dart programming language. They improve the coding experience on the lower level and at the micro scale. The only tricky tool to use is the icon. How To Use. Note: Offline persistence is supported only in Android, iOS, and web apps. Installation# 1. Flutter developers interested in sharing code … Once you have the cashes, you should be able to run flutter create --offline and flutter packages get --offline. If you are new to SQLite and SQL statements, go ahead & learn the basics of SQLite from SQL Tutorial. dependencies: flutter: sdk: flutter. Documentation. It has played a significant role in making software … I wanted to be able to use flutter offline on my PC. Gradle technically does cache resources system-wide so you might be okay running it offline with a new project, but cocoapods does not. I looked up the net and found that the –offline flag is used for that. All of this is achieved with the best hybrid app frameworks, including Flutter and React Native. flutter, rxdart, select_dialog. In this post, we will Create and Run Background Services using Flutter code in Android. Hope you got a good advice, if yes clap & share. Flutter, being a very Versatile solution for programming, allows us to write platform-specific code to achieve your background tasks! Since the Flutter application is a native app, it’s not considered a “confidential client” and a client secret isn’t safe. sales@solaceinfotech.co.in +1 71886 58876 +91 94034 61611. Running background services is one of the most important tasks that we can perform in an Android or iOS app. You have to use the ‘Connectivity Flutter Package’ to achieve this feature on your App. Zoey Fan, product manager for Flutter, recently announced that Codepen, a popular online code playground, is now supporting Flutter. It could be found by decompiling the application. SQLite is a SQL engine used in mobile devices and some computers. ... Step4: Create the files which is required for Offline VideoPlayer. I tried running the following: flutter create testapp --offline Output: C:\Users\Snehit\Documents\GitHub>flutter create testapp --offline Multiple output directories specified. This greatly simplified cross platform development. firebase_core: "^0.5.3" cloud_firestore: "^0.14.4" 2. The plugin is well-maintained and is recommended by the Flutter team as well. The Flutter tutorials teach you how to use the Flutter framework to build mobile applications for iOS and Android. In offline mode, it will need to have all dependencies already available in the pub cache to succeed. Why should I use Flutter Progressive Web App? You can also use it for news agency, personal blog, technical blog, journal, local news or online newspaper to the next level with this news system. Homepage Repository (GitHub) View/report issues. You’re all set! To use offline persistence, you don't need to make any changes to the code that you use to access Cloud Firestore data. Because of the complexities of dealing with Core Data, when I was developing iOS apps I ended up ignoring Core Data and just using an SQLite plugin. Nubank, the bank from Brazil, created their Flutter app to allow clients to use their digital bank accounts through the convenience of their smartphones. Copy. In this tutorial, we’ll take a look at using sqlite in flutter. SQLite in flutter can be used to persist data in Android and iOS apps. In Android Studio you could double tap shift to bring up the search everywhere command window. flutter packages pub publish --dry-run. That’s it your plugin will be live in one or two minutes. In iOS we would use Core Data and in Android we would use SQLite to store that kind of data. If there is a need to display images or handle data files that accessible offline, those need to be store on that device as assets. License. Add dependency# pubspec.yaml. You have to subscribe StreamSubscription returned by this package to show the internet connection message automatically like below. Flutter does not provide a built-in abstraction for accessing the SQLite Database. 6. Persistent storage can be useful for caching network calls while fresh data is loaded and for offline apps. In this Offline VideoPage class we extend StatefulWidget so let me tell you what is StatefulWidget. The app allows for unlimited money transfers (scheduled and in real-time), controlling expenses, transactions, payments and issuance intuitively. 2 years ago. Thanks for your time. Download dependency# Copy $ flutter pub get. Also, when I enable internet connectivity, everything works fine. Developers or beginners who are waiting for the best flutter online courses, hen this is more advantageous place to choose the course. Click on a component to edit it using the editors in the bottom middle. Within a terminal you can do that via flutter run --release. flutter_offline package; documentation; flutter_offline. Offline cache sync . HOME; SERVICES; ABOUT US; CASE STUDIES; CAREER; BLOGS; CONTACT US +1 71886 58876. From this flutter online course students will learn the topics like creation of applications for android and ios devices, implementation of model view controller I am using Flutter framework language to use this application. We can use it to persist data for our app. 3. Best flutter plugins to use in 2020. It also has a reward program. Libraries; flutter_offline ️ Flutter Offline. Uploader. flutter packages pub publish. Upvoted becuase I need the docs on my laptop as well. davidsdearaujo@gmail.com. Run flutter packages get. It keeps your data in sync across client apps through realtime listeners and offers offline support so you can build responsive apps that work regardless of network latency or Internet connectivity. Now, when you’ve seen the difference between cross-platform and native approach, we can discuss their advantages and disadvantages. API reference. Android toolchain - develop for Android devices (Android SDK version 29.0.0-rc1) ! Just hover over the tool in th e middle to see its name, drag it into the phone’s canvas and drop it. A tidy utility to handle offline/online connectivity like a Boss. However, using the SQFlite plugin, one can access the SQLite database on both Android & iOS. Flutter - How to Run Background Task? Dependencies. With offline persistence enabled, the Cloud Firestore client library automatically manages online and offline data access and synchronizes local data when the device is back online. Doing this with Flutter and Rest API is very tedious. Re: We need offline copy of the flutter documentation : eseidel: 11/12/18 8:45 AM: This has been asked for before. This package helps to know either your device is online or offline. Mobile experience expects that it is offline enabled by default. Doctor summary (to see all details, run flutter doctor -v): [ ] Flutter (Channel stable, v1.12.13+hotfix.5, on Mac OS X 10.14.6 18G2022, locale en-ID) [!] For versions of the Maps SDK for iOS lower than v5.3.0 and the Maps SDK for Android lower than v. 8.3.0, there is a default offline tile limit of 6,000 tiles per user (or about the size of the San Francisco Bay Area).This means each of your users may download up to 6,000 tiles for offline use at one time. However, I don’t seem to understand how to use this flag. This is probably a duplicate of #1945 though. Classic Flutter News is Ideal for your magazine, blog, news portal. Before getting started we have to make sure that our mobile PC Suite software should be installed on our Computer. Flutter is the open source framework for developing the mobile applications. Make sure the “Require authentication” checkbox is set to off. Skip to content. Some Android licenses not accepted. I am able to run flutter packages get --offline in the already created projects without any problems. Top 10 Flutter Libraries And Plugins To Use In 2020 . With all the advantages of the Flutter SDK and Dart programming language one can develop applications for most of the major platforms. Contents in this project Run Test Flutter Apps Directly on Real Android Device in Windows MAC PC Tutorial: 1. After everything is fixed run the below command to publish it. MIT . Includes all required flutter source code. Using Types in Dart Types allows to provide a clear intent in our code. Learn about how offline maps work. We’ll use this redirect URL in our Flutter application later. We need offline copy of the flutter documentation Showing 1-7 of 7 messages. I am using my Redmi Note 5 Pro mobile phone for testing flutter application so i am installing MI’s official PC suite in my windows pc. Simple and robust FindDropdown with item search feature, making it possible to use an offline item list or filtering URL for easy customization. This would not be hard to create. Also you can find this in the menu under "Run" just like so: share | improve this answer | follow | answered May 17 '19 at 4:45. Otherwise, you can skip the verification step. Note: As of Flutter’s 1.19.0 dev release, the Flutter SDK contains the dart command alongside the flutter command so that you can more easily run Dart command-line programs. Click on the source tab to see the generated flutter code. Career ; BLOGS ; CONTACT us +1 71886 58876 allows for unlimited money transfers ( and! Ios apps advice, if yes clap & share set to off can access the Database..., we ’ ll use this redirect URL in our flutter application later and flutter packages pub publish --.... In Dart Types allows to provide a built-in abstraction for accessing the SQLite Database how to use an offline list... To effectively ignore the entire platform and in Android and iOS apps t seem to understand how to use the. What is StatefulWidget the only tricky tool to use the flutter SDK and Dart programming language for best! Be installed on our Computer # 1945 though web apps, iOS, and web apps package helps to either. A whole new level by allowing us to effectively ignore the entire platform, we ’ ll take a at. Dart Types allows to provide a clear intent in our code to run flutter create -- offline everywhere command.. To understand how to use in 2020, transactions, payments and intuitively! Tasks that we can discuss their advantages and disadvantages flutter apps Directly on Real Android Device in Windows MAC Tutorial... Mobile devices and some computers will create and run background SERVICES using flutter code Android. Loaded and for offline apps that kind of data SERVICES using flutter code in Android, iOS, and apps! The micro scale the editors in the bottom middle that you use to access Cloud Firestore data project... & iOS the search everywhere command window offline enabled by default make sure that our PC! Ahead & learn the basics of SQLite from SQL Tutorial, News portal or offline statements go. ‘ connectivity flutter package ’ to achieve your background tasks as well to find the flutter and! Quite easy to customize as per your need for News publishing requirement calls while fresh is. In release mode command, and web apps their advantages and disadvantages, you will the!, News portal verification to Firebase that you use to access Cloud Firestore data up. Of data flutter News is Ideal for your magazine, blog, portal. Ll use this redirect URL in our flutter application later, being a development. This is achieved with the best flutter online courses, hen this is probably a duplicate #! Of SQLite from SQL Tutorial projects without any problems tell you what is StatefulWidget helps know. Post, we ’ ll use this application be live in one or two minutes offline flutter... To Firebase that you 've successfully integrated Firebase a very Versatile solution for programming, allows us to write code... I looked up the net and found that the –offline flag is used for that is a! The process of creating a new project, you will use the flutter CLI tool language one develop! Extend StatefulWidget so let me tell you what is StatefulWidget flutter SDK and programming! The coding experience on the lower level and at the micro scale documentation 1-7!: 1 a look at using SQLite in flutter can be useful for caching network calls fresh. Transfers ( scheduled and in real-time ), controlling expenses, transactions payments... Offline and can be used to persist data for our app possible to use an offline item list filtering... Hybrid app frameworks, including flutter and Rest API is very tedious SQLite and statements! Access the SQLite Database on both Android & iOS might be okay running it offline a. –Offline flag is used for that manager for flutter, recently announced that Codepen a... Helps to know either your Device is online or offline I enable internet connectivity, everything works.... So you might be okay running it offline with a new project, should... Note: offline persistence is supported only in Android improve the coding experience on the lower and. Will create and run background SERVICES using flutter code in Android post, we will create and background! Files which is required for offline VideoPlayer access Cloud Firestore data flutter Libraries and Plugins to in... Set to off to handle offline/online connectivity like a Boss be useful for caching network calls fresh. Significant role in making software … I am using flutter framework language use! Framework to build mobile applications storage can be useful for caching network calls while data., a popular online code playground, is now supporting flutter entire platform this.... The only tricky tool to use the flutter run -- release two.. More advantageous place to choose the course that via flutter run main.dart in release command! Caching network calls while fresh data is loaded and for offline apps used persist!, iOS, and web apps changed the manner in which software is written and distributed is! Playground, is now supporting flutter you 've successfully integrated Firebase added Analytics, your... Works fine on our Computer Studio you could double tap shift to bring the. Applications in no time `` ^0.5.3 '' cloud_firestore: `` ^0.14.4 '' 2 pub cache to.... Test flutter apps Directly on Real Android Device in Windows MAC PC Tutorial 1! Our mobile PC Suite software should be installed on our Computer accessing the SQLite Database in the pub to... More information ABOUT managing packages and Plugins, refer to using packages you will use the flutter flutter run offline! What is StatefulWidget for easy customization bring up the net and found that the –offline flag used... Flutter does not provide a built-in abstraction for accessing the SQLite Database both. In flutter using packages Cloud Firestore data frameworks, including flutter and Rest API is very tedious Rest API very! Command to publish it the manner in which software is written and distributed am: enough.! Release mode command to find the flutter SDK and Dart programming language one can develop for! Flutter create -- offline, when I enable internet connectivity, everything works fine is to. Be able to find the flutter documentation: eseidel: 11/12/18 8:45 am: enough said to use persistence... Zablon Dawit: 11/11/18 5:03 am: this has been asked for before persistence supported. Is used for that: this has been asked for before copy of the flutter framework to build applications. Storage can be useful for caching network calls while fresh data is loaded for. Android Device in Windows MAC PC Tutorial: 1 to show the internet connection message like... Process of creating a new project, you will use the flutter team as well run flutter create --...., run your app to send verification to Firebase that you use access. Flutter developers interested in sharing code … flutter packages get -- offline in the pub cache to succeed Device. The advantages of the flutter SDK and Dart programming language well-maintained and is recommended the! Your background tasks looked up the search everywhere command window and issuance intuitively has been asked for before look using. Our Computer enable internet connectivity, everything works fine to bring up the search everywhere window... It offline with a new project, but cocoapods does not provide a clear intent in code. Playground, is now supporting flutter feature on your app the difference between cross-platform and native approach, can! Doing this with flutter and React native entire platform besides, they efficiently function offline flutter... Item search feature, making it possible to use this application our app access Cloud data! & share mobile experience expects that it is quite easy to customize as per your need for publishing! Found that the –offline flag is used for that efficiently function offline and flutter packages pub publish -- dry-run cache. Either your Device is online or offline some computers flutter_offline API docs, for the best flutter online,! Click on the source tab to see the generated flutter code in Android, iOS, and apps! And robust FindDropdown with item search feature, making it possible to use an offline item list or filtering for. Dependencies already available in the bottom middle important tasks that we can perform in an Android or app... In flutter can be used to persist data for our app, making it possible to use flutter offline my.: `` ^0.5.3 '' cloud_firestore: `` ^0.14.4 '' 2 with a new project... Performance-Oriented applications in no time terminal you can do that via flutter run -- release persistence supported! To handle offline/online connectivity like a Boss on my PC only tricky tool to use this flag money... And in Android you should be able to run flutter create -- offline running it offline with a new,! This post, we will create and run background SERVICES using flutter framework to! Code … flutter packages get -- offline in the already created projects without any.. To use in 2020 the below command to publish it tap shift to bring up the search everywhere command.! S it your plugin will be live in one or two minutes code to achieve this feature your... To write platform-specific code to achieve your background tasks are waiting for the programming... A component to edit it using the SQFlite plugin, one can develop applications for most of most. It using the editors in the already created projects without any problems you double! Flutter Libraries and Plugins, refer to using packages expects that it is quite easy to customize per... Hybrid app frameworks, including flutter and Rest API is very tedious in this post, we create! +1 71886 58876 +91 94034 61611 courses, hen this is probably a duplicate #! Core data and in real-time ), controlling expenses, transactions, payments and issuance.... Our flutter application later what is StatefulWidget `` ^0.14.4 '' 2 easy customization 11/11/18 5:03 am: has. To the app allows for unlimited money transfers ( scheduled and in ).